Are Oreos are vegan is the question shoppers type when they flip the package over, and the short answer is that classic Oreos contain no animal ingredients, so they are technically free of dairy, eggs, and other animal products, but Oreo’s own maker does not label them as suitable for vegans because they are produced on lines that also handle milk and carry a “may contain milk” cross-contact warning. That single fact is why this question gets a messier answer than most people expect: by ingredients, an Oreo is a plant-based cookie, yet by the strictest reading of the label and the manufacturer’s own position, it falls into a gray area. Where you land depends on how you personally treat cross-contamination warnings, which is a choice many vegans make differently.
This guide cuts through the confusion. It walks through exactly what is in a classic Oreo, why the cookie has no dairy in its recipe despite the creamy white filling, what the “may contain milk” statement actually means, where Oreo’s maker stands, which flavors are plant-based and which are not, and the two ethical wrinkles (bone-char sugar and palm oil) that some vegans weigh on top of the basic ingredient question. By the end you will be able to read any Oreo package and decide for yourself, with a clear understanding of why the answer is “yes by ingredients, your call on cross-contact” rather than a flat yes or no.
What is actually in a classic Oreo
The whole question starts with the ingredient list, and it is more plant-based than the cookie’s appearance suggests. A classic Oreo is built from these core ingredients: wheat flour, sugar, palm and/or canola oil, cocoa, high fructose corn syrup or other sweeteners, leavening, salt, soy lecithin, and artificial flavor. Nowhere on that list is milk, butter, eggs, or any other animal-derived ingredient. The cookie wafers get their color from cocoa, and the filling, despite looking like a dairy cream, is made from sugar and vegetable oil whipped together, not from milk or cream.
This surprises people because the white “creme” center looks and is named like a dairy product. It is not. The creamy texture comes from the fat in the vegetable oil and the structure of the whipped sugar, with soy lecithin acting as an emulsifier to hold it together smoothly. Soy lecithin is plant-derived, so it does not change the answer, the same reassuring story behind whether soy sauce is vegan. By a straight reading of the ingredients, then, a classic Oreo contains nothing from an animal, which is why so many lists of “accidentally vegan” snacks include it. This is the same label-reading skill that helps sort out other packaged products, the way our breakdown of whether Sour Patch Kids are vegan walks through a candy’s list line by line.
Why the filling has no dairy

Because the creme is the part that looks most suspect, it deserves a closer look. The Oreo filling is essentially a fat-and-sugar system: vegetable oil provides the rich, smooth body, sugar provides sweetness and structure, and a small amount of soy lecithin keeps the mixture emulsified and stable. Vanillin or artificial flavor gives it the familiar taste. None of those components comes from milk.
The reason this matters is that many cookie and snack fillings do use dairy (milk powder, butter, whey), so it is a fair thing to check. Oreo’s choice to build the filling from vegetable oil instead is part of why the cookie reads as plant-based at the ingredient level. The lesson is to never assume a creamy filling means dairy; the ingredient list is the only reliable guide, and in the Oreo’s case it comes back clean. That leaves the cross-contamination question as the real sticking point, not the recipe itself.
The “may contain milk” warning explained
This is the heart of the whole debate, so it is worth understanding precisely. Oreo packaging in many regions carries a statement like “may contain milk” or “produced in a facility that also processes milk.” This is not an ingredient. It is a cross-contact allergen warning, meaning the cookies are made on shared equipment or in shared facilities where dairy-containing products are also produced, so trace amounts of milk could end up in a batch.
These advisory statements are voluntary in many places and are aimed primarily at people with severe milk allergies, for whom even a trace is a real medical risk. They do not mean the recipe contains milk. For someone with a dairy allergy, the warning is a genuine caution and Oreos may not be safe. For a vegan, the question is philosophical rather than medical: does an unintended trace from shared equipment make a product non-vegan? Different vegans answer that differently, which is exactly why the cookie sits in a gray zone instead of a clear category.
Where Oreo’s maker stands
It helps to know the company’s own position, because it is more cautious than the ingredient list alone would suggest. Oreo’s maker has stated that because of the milk cross-contact, the cookies are not suitable for vegans. In other words, the company will not officially call them vegan, specifically because of the shared-facility dairy risk, even though they do not add any dairy to the recipe.
This is an important distinction. The manufacturer is not saying Oreos contain milk; it is declining to certify them as vegan because it cannot guarantee zero dairy contact. That conservative stance is common among large food companies, which prefer to warn rather than risk an allergic reaction or a misleading claim. So the honest framing is: the recipe is plant-based, the company will not vouch for vegan suitability because of cross-contact, and the final call rests with the individual.
How vegans actually treat cross-contamination
Since the recipe is clean and only cross-contact is at issue, the practical question becomes how strict you want to be, and there is an established framework for it. The widely cited definition of veganism from The Vegan Society describes avoiding animal products “as far as is possible and practicable.” That phrasing matters here.
Under the “possible and practicable” standard, most vegans treat a “may contain milk” cross-contamination warning as acceptable, because the trace is unintentional and avoiding every shared-facility product would make eating nearly impossible. By this common reading, Oreos are considered vegan-friendly, and they appear on countless “accidentally vegan” lists for that reason. A stricter minority avoids any product with a dairy cross-contact warning, in which case Oreos would not qualify. Neither position is wrong; they are different interpretations of the same facts. If you follow the mainstream practicable standard, classic Oreos are fine; if you avoid all cross-contact, they are not. The broader nutrition and ethics context for choices like this is well covered at Forks Over Knives.
Which Oreo flavors are plant-based and which are not
Not every Oreo variety has the same clean list, so checking the specific flavor matters. The classic and many common flavors keep the same dairy-free recipe, while a handful of specialty types add animal ingredients. Here is a general guide, though you should always confirm on the current package since recipes change by region and over time.
The pattern is clear: the standard sandwich cookies keep the plant-based recipe, while anything coated, soft-baked, or specially formulated is where added dairy or egg can appear. The fudge-covered and cake-style products are the most likely to break the pattern. When in doubt, the ingredient list on the exact package you are holding settles it, since a coating or a soft-baked texture often signals added animal ingredients.
The two ethical wrinkles: sugar and palm oil

For vegans who weigh ethics beyond the literal ingredient list, two extra issues come up with Oreos, so here is the honest read on each. Neither involves an animal ingredient in the cookie, but both are reasons some vegans hesitate.
Bone-char sugar. In the United States, some cane sugar is filtered through bone char (charred animal bone) during refining. The sugar itself contains no bone char, but the process uses an animal product, which strict vegans avoid. This is not unique to Oreos; it affects most products made with conventional US cane sugar. Organic and beet sugar do not use bone char. Many vegans, and organizations like PETA, treat bone-char sugar as acceptable under the practicable standard, while stricter vegans avoid it.
Palm oil. Oreos typically contain palm oil, which is plant-derived and therefore vegan by definition, but its production is linked to deforestation and habitat loss for endangered species like orangutans. Some vegans avoid or limit palm oil on environmental and animal-welfare grounds, even though it is not an animal ingredient. Oreo’s maker has faced criticism over palm oil sourcing. Whether this matters to you is a separate, values-based decision from the dairy question.
How to read an Oreo label like a vegan
Because recipes and warnings vary by region and change over time, the most useful skill is knowing how to scan any package quickly, so here is the routine. Start with the ingredient list itself and look for the obvious dairy words: milk, milk powder, whey, butter, casein, and lactose. A classic Oreo will not list any of these. Then look for egg, which can show up in soft-baked or cake-style products. If the list is clean of both, the recipe is plant-based.
Next, find the allergen advisory line, usually printed just below or after the ingredients. A statement like “contains milk” means dairy is actually in the product and it is not vegan. A statement like “may contain milk” or “made in a facility that also processes milk” is the cross-contact warning, which is the gray-area case discussed above, not an ingredient. Telling those two apart is the single most important label skill, because “contains” and “may contain” mean very different things. Finally, glance for a vegan certification logo if you want a guaranteed product; its presence means the brand has verified both ingredients and, often, cross-contact controls. With those three checks (dairy words, the advisory line, and any certification) you can judge any cookie in about ten seconds.
A small bonus tip for the classic vegan Oreo experience: dunk them in a plant milk. Oat or soy milk gives the creamiest dunk and keeps the whole snack plant-based, sidestepping the dairy milk most people reach for out of habit. Oat milk in particular matches the cookie’s sweetness without overpowering it, and because the warning is about trace dairy rather than added dairy, pairing the cookie with a plant milk keeps the rest of your snack squarely plant-based regardless of where you land on the cross-contact question.
What to do if you want a guaranteed plant-based cookie
If the cross-contact warning or the ethical wrinkles bother you, there are clean alternatives, so you are not stuck. Several brands make sandwich cookies that are certified vegan, with no dairy facility warning and often organic, non-bone-char sugar and sustainable palm oil or no palm oil at all. Reading for a vegan certification logo is the fastest way to find them.
The most satisfying route, though, is homemade. A from-scratch chocolate sandwich cookie lets you control every ingredient: use beet or organic sugar to sidestep bone char, choose your fat, and skip any cross-contact entirely. Recipe resources like Minimalist Baker have plant-based cookie recipes that recreate the Oreo experience without any of the gray areas. For everyday snacking, though, most vegans who follow the practicable standard simply enjoy the classic cookie and move on.
Frequently asked questions
Do Oreos contain milk or dairy?
Classic Oreos do not contain milk or dairy in the recipe. The creme filling is made from sugar and vegetable oil, not cream or butter, and the wafers contain no dairy. However, the packaging carries a “may contain milk” warning because the cookies are made on shared equipment that also processes dairy, so trace cross-contact is possible.
Why does Oreo say they are not suitable for vegans?
Oreo’s maker says they are not suitable for vegans specifically because of milk cross-contact in their facilities, not because the recipe contains dairy. The company will not certify them as vegan since it cannot guarantee zero trace of milk from shared production lines. The ingredients themselves are plant-based; the caution is about cross-contamination.
Are Oreos considered vegan by most vegans?
Most vegans consider classic Oreos acceptable under The Vegan Society’s “as far as possible and practicable” standard, which treats unintentional cross-contact traces as unavoidable. By that common reading they are vegan-friendly and appear on many accidentally-vegan lists. A stricter minority who avoid all dairy cross-contact warnings would not eat them. It comes down to your personal standard.
Which Oreo flavors are not vegan?
The standard sandwich cookies keep the plant-based recipe, but coated, soft-baked, and some specialty types can contain dairy or egg. Fudge-covered Oreos, Cakesters or soft-baked styles, and certain seasonal or limited editions are the ones most likely to include animal ingredients. Always check the ingredient list on the specific package, since recipes vary by flavor and region.
Is the sugar in Oreos vegan?
The sugar in Oreos contains no animal ingredient, but in the US some cane sugar is refined using bone char, an animal-derived filter. The sugar itself has none in it, yet strict vegans avoid sugar processed this way. Organic and beet sugar do not use bone char. Many vegans accept it under the practicable standard, while stricter ones avoid it.
Is palm oil in Oreos vegan?
Palm oil is plant-derived, so it is technically vegan, and Oreos typically contain it. The concern some vegans raise is environmental: palm oil production is linked to deforestation and harm to endangered species like orangutans. That is an ethical and ecological consideration separate from whether the ingredient is animal-based, and it leads some vegans to limit palm oil even though it is not from an animal.
The bottom line
Classic Oreos are plant-based by ingredients, with a creme filling made from sugar and vegetable oil rather than dairy, no eggs, and no other animal products in the recipe. The reason they are not a clean “yes” is the “may contain milk” warning: the cookies are made on shared equipment with dairy, so Oreo’s own maker declines to call them vegan-suitable. Most vegans, following the “as far as possible and practicable” standard, treat classic Oreos as acceptable, while stricter vegans who avoid all cross-contact warnings do not. On top of that sit two values-based wrinkles, bone-char sugar and palm oil, that some vegans weigh. Read the exact package, avoid the coated and soft-baked specialty types, and decide based on your own standard. By ingredients the answer is yes; on cross-contact and ethics, the call is honestly yours to make.




